Patent number: 8321945Abstract: A security measure status self-checking system which can determine the security measure status in a more simplified and effective manner by focusing on the information leakage measure in the security measures, managing the PC's security measure status and the user's take-out operation status in an integrated and unitary manner, and providing security policy samples. Accordingly, the client computer collects security inventory information and operation log information and transmits the information to the server computer. Further, the server computer stores the security inventory information and the operation log information transmitted from the client computer and determines whether or not the information conforms to the security policy which has been set in advance. The check result is displayed on the server computer and when a policy violation is detected, the manager and the client are notified of that effect.Type: GrantFiled: June 3, 2008Date of Patent: November 27, 2012Assignee: Hitachi Solutions, Ltd.Inventor: Katsuyuki Nakagawa

Publication number: 20030190577Abstract: The present invention provides an orthodontic bracket having a bonding surface that has excellent adhesiveness to a tooth surface due to undercuts having been formed by plastic deformation. A bracket 1 that is bonded to a tooth surface using an adhesive for orthodontic treatment is made from a plastic, specifically a polycarbonate or a polyamide. A bonding surface 4 of the bracket 1 is constituted from recessed parts 4a and protruding parts 4b. A projecting member 6 having a-tip part thereof formed into an approximately V-shaped pointed shape is pushed into an outside edge part of each protruding part 4b, whereby the protruding part 4b is pushed outward via a groove 4c. Side walls of each protruding part 4b thus spread out toward the recessed parts 4a, whereby undercuts 5 are formed in the bonding surface 4.Type: ApplicationFiled: March 27, 2003Publication date: October 9, 2003Inventors: Yoshiharu Shin, Kazuo Machida, Katsuyuki Nakagawa

Patent number: 6354834Abstract: An orthodontic supporting structure of the present invention comprises an implant unit which is implantable in a jaw bone and a connecting unit which includes an arm part having a fastening portion. The implant unit has a narrow part in its upper portion. The connecting unit further includes an engaging part having an opening at one end. The engaging part fits on the narrow part of the implant unit. The connecting unit can be attached to the implant unit in a simple way by sliding the engaging part along the narrow part and then crimping far ends of the engaging part.Type: GrantFiled: December 18, 2000Date of Patent: March 12, 2002Assignee: Sankin Kogyo Kabushiki KaishaInventors: Ryuzo Kanomi, Katsuyuki Nakagawa, Yoshiharu Shin

Patent number: 6164964Abstract: An orthodontic appliance of the present invention has a combination of a bracket with a hook and a bracket without a hook.The bracket with a hook includes a metal body formed with a groove therein adapted for being engaged with an arch wire and provided with a hook thereon, the hook is integrally formed with the metal body; and a synthetic resin housing for accommodating the metal body therein such that inner surface of the groove is exposed and at least top portion of the hook projects from the synthetic resin housing. The bracket without a hook includes a metal body formed with a groove therein adapted for being engaged with an arch wire; and a synthetic resin housing for accommodating the metal body therein such that inner surface of the groove is exposed.Type: GrantFiled: June 18, 1999Date of Patent: December 26, 2000Assignee: Sankin Kogyo Kabushiki KaishaInventor: Katsuyuki Nakagawa

Patent number: 5921774Abstract: The present invention provides a supporting body for use in an orthodontic appliance capable of applying a force to the tooth to be treated from the most preferable position. The supporting body includes an implant member having a maximum dimension across the thereof cross section of 2 mm or less for being implanted in a jaw bone (i.e. the maxilla and/or mandibula), and an exposed member forming one end of the supporting body to be exposed to inside of mouth. The exposed portion includes an extended arm and the arm is formed with a hook.Type: GrantFiled: August 6, 1997Date of Patent: July 13, 1999Assignee: Sankin Kogyo kabushiki KaishaInventors: Ryuzo Kanomi, Katsuyuki Nakagawa

Patent number: 4419072Abstract: A handy torch comprises a tank, a first valve mechanism, a second valve mechanism, a burner having a nozzle and an air-intake opening. A pipe connects the second valve mechanism with the burner. The first valve mechanism includes a first valve body having a cylindrical inner wall with a female thread and a valve seat, an actuating member having a male thread screwed with the female thread of the first valve body, a disc, a resilient O-ring disposed between the valve seat and the disc. The O-ring is designed such that the gas flowing from an entrance of the first valve mechanism can be controlled by the O-ring in cooperation with the disc and the valve seat. A suction material connects the male thread of the actuating member with the gas in the tank. The second valve mechanism includes a second valve body having a passage and a through-hole with a female thread, and a needle having a male thread screwed with the female thread of the second valve body for controlling the gas flowing through the passage.Type: GrantFiled: March 10, 1982Date of Patent: December 6, 1983Assignee: Sankin Industry Co., Ltd.Inventors: Katsuyuki Nakagawa, Naoki Oda

Patent number: 3973541Abstract: A governor for use in a fuel injection pump for controlling the fuel control rod of such a fuel injection pump wherein the fulcrum of the lever connected to the fuel control rod is moved after the fuel control rod follows the movement of the lever only on a part of the accelerating travel when the accelerator lever is abruptly operated, and thus sharp increases in the amount of fuel injection are prevented so as to preclude the exhausting of black smoke from the engine.Type: GrantFiled: May 29, 1974Date of Patent: August 10, 1976Assignee: Kabushiki Kaisha Komatsu SeisakushoInventors: Yoshiatsu Nakamura, Hisato Nozawa, Takuji Isomura, Katsuyuki Nakagawa
